Use of high-level HBV replication transgenic mice for evaluating drugs treating hepatitis B virus / 中国病理生理杂志

ABSTRACT

AIM:

To study the high-level HBV replication transgenic mice for evaluation of drugs treating hepatitis B virus.

METHODS:

The HBV transgenic mice were treated respectively with lamivudine,large dose recombinant hepatitis B protein vaccine,?-1b interferon,siRNA to evaluate their pharmacodynamics and mechanism of action.

RESULTS:

HBV DNA titre was reduced significantly in transgenic mice which were treated with lamivudine(100 mg?kg-1?d-1),recombinant hepatitis B protein vaccine(HBsAg 6 ?g/mouse),?-1b interferon(50 ?g /mouse),respectively.Recombinant hepatitis B protein vaccine and ?-1b interferon promoted the level of IL-2 and IFN-? and increased the Elispot number of spleen cells secreting IFN-? in the treated transgenic mice.HBV transgenic mice were treated with RNAi expression vector pU6-siHBV against HBV through vena caudalis by hydrodynamics technique.Five days later,the level of serum HBsAg was reduced by 56.7% and the inhibition lasted at least 14 days.The HbcAg(+)cells were decreased obviously by immunohistochemistry detection in liver tissue,but the RNAi did not reduce the serum HBV DNA titre.

CONCLUSION:

These inbreeding high-level HBV replication transgenic mice are reliable and feasible for evaluating the anti-HBV drugs and have its economical and convenient superiority.
